Changes: - Get rid of the south_station mainboard specific code and use the platform generic function wrapper that was added in change http://review.coreboot.org/#/c/2497/ AMD f14: Add SPD read functions to wrapper code - Move DIMM addresses into devicetree.cb - Add the ASF init that used to be in the SPD read code into mainboard_enable() Notes: - The DIMM reads only happen in romstage, so the function is not available in ramstage. Point the read-SPD callback to a generic function in ramstage.
